Caring for Your Radio

The radio casting
!
has a vent port
that allows for
a u t i o n
pressure
equalization in the
radio. Never poke
this vent with any
objects, such as
needles, tweezers,
or screwdrivers.
This could create
leak paths into the
radio and the
radio's
submergibility will
be lost.
